Paola GARBAGNOLI

Customer Experience Designer in ABB.

 

Paola GARBAGNOLI worked on the Future Mobility Sensing (FMS) project in SMART: Future Urban Mobility – IRG from 2014 to 2016 as a UI Designer. She has subsequently progress to became a Customer Experience Designer in ABB (ABBN: SIX Swiss Ex).

ABOUT

The Future Urban Mobility (FM) Interdisciplinary Research Group (IRG) is 1 of 5 IRGs in the Singapore-MIT Alliance for Research and Technology Centre (SMART). SMART-FM is supported by the National Research Foundation (NRF) Singapore and situated in the Campus for Research Excellence and Technological Enterprise (CREATE).
